1.
Cost of Living Index Number is constructed to study the effect of changes in the price of goods and services of consumers for a current period as compared with the base period. The change in the cost of living index number between any two periods means the change in income which will be necessary to maintain the same standard of living in both the periods. Therefore the cost of living index number measures the average increase in the cost to maintain the same standard of life.
Further, the consumption habits of people differ widely from class to class (rich, poor, middle class) and even with the region. The changes in the price level affect the different classes of people, consequently, the general price index numbers fail to reflect the effect of changes in their cost of living in different classes of people. Therefore, the cost of living index number measures the general price movement of the commodities consumed by different classes of people.
2.
The ratio between the total value of current period and total value of the base period is known as true value ratio.
(\( \frac{\sum P_{1} q_{1}}{\sum p_{0} q_{0}}\) is a true value tario)
3.
Factor reversal test is another test for testing the consistency of a good index number. The product of price index number and quantity index number from the base year to the current year should be equal to the true value ratio. That is ratio between the total value of current period and total value of the base period is known as true value ratio. Factor reversal test is given by,
\(\text { i.e. } P_{01} \times Q_{01}=\frac{\sum P_{1} q_{1}}{\sum p_{0} q_{0}}=V_{01}(\text { Except the factor 100) }\)
4.
Time reversal test is an important test for testing the consistency of a good index number. This test maintains time consistency by working both forward and backward with respect to time (here time refers to base year and current year). Symbolically the following Relationship should be satisfied, P01 \(\times\) P10 = 1 Fisher's index number formula satisfies the above relationship
\(\text { i.e. } P_{01}=\frac{1}{P_{10}} \text { or } P_{01} \times P_{10}=1(\text { Except the factor } 100 \text { ) }\)
5.
Index numbers are studied to know the relative changes in price and quantity for any two years compared. There are two tests which are used to test the adequacy for an index number. The two tests are as follows.
(i) Time reversal test
(ii) Factor reversal test
The criterion for a good index number is to satisfy the above two tests.
6.
Fisher's price index number is the geometric mean of Laspeyre's and Paasche's price index number. Hence it is weighted index number.
Fisher's price index number = \(\sqrt {\frac {\sum p_{1}q_{0}}{\sum p_{0}q_{0} }}{\times}{\frac {\sum p_{1}q_{1}}{\sum p_{0}q_{1}} \times {100}}\)

10.
The two normal equations are
\(\sum\) Y = n a + b \(\sum\) X
\(\sum\) XY = a \(\sum\) X + b \(\sum\)X2 where n is the number of years given in the data.
11.
Seasonal index is a measure of how a particular season compares with the average season.
12.
Irregular variations do not have particular pattern and there is no regular period of time of their occurrences. Normally they are short terms variations but its occurrence sometimes has its effect so intense that they may give rise to new cyclic or other movements of variations.
For example floods, wars, earthquakes, Tsunami, strikes, lockouts etc.
13.
Cyclic uniformly periodic in nature. They may or may not follow exactly similar patterns after equal intervals of time. Generally one cyclic period ranges from 7 to.9 years and there is no hard and fast rule in the fixation of years for a cyclic period. For example, every business cycle has a Start-Boom-Depression- Recover maintenance during booms and depressions, changes in government monetary policies, changes in interestrates.
14.
The different methods of measurements of trends are
(i) Free hand or graphic method
(ii) Method of semi averages
(iii) Method of moving averages
(iv) Method of least squares
